Overview
- The pilot went missing Tuesday afternoon after departing Eisenhüttenstadt-Politz with a group of eight paragliders
- Police and Bundeswehr helicopters joined the search once his cellphone was located late Tuesday evening
- Crews discovered the motorized glider and the man’s body hanging in a treetop near Jamlitz around 12:45 a.m.
- Authorities have opened a formal investigation to establish the moment and cause of his death
- The latest fatal crash follows a series of powered paragliding accidents this spring that have spurred calls for tighter safety regulations and training standards
